Problems solved by technology

[0003] The defect that the relevant technology exists is: because the driver of the walking operation type stacking forklift is to walk and follow the forklift to operate the forklift, and the handle operating rod has a length of about 1 meter, therefore, even if the handle operating rod is pushed down In the case of a small angle, the speed of the forklift can still reach the highest
There is no buffer in the process of increasing the speed of the vehicle, resulting in the forklift not starting smoothly
And if the acceleration knob is turned to the maximum at this time, the forklift will quickly reach the maximum speed, and the driver has not yet had time to walk at the maximum speed of the forklift to keep pace with the forklift due to inertia, so it is easy for the forklift to pull the driver to run situation, and in this case, it is easy for the driver to make a wrong operation and cause a safety accident

Abstract

The invention discloses a speed control method of a forklift. The method includes the steps that a swinging angle signal is generated according to the swinging angle of an operating handle; the angle section where the swinging angle is located is determined according to the swinging angle signal, and the swinging angle of the operating handle of the forklift includes multiple angle sections; the rotating amplitude of an accelerating knob in the forklift is detected; and the running speed of the forklift is controlled according to the swinging angle signal, the angle section where the swinging angle is located and the rotating amplitude of the accelerating knob. By means of the speed control method of the forklift, the forklift can be controlled to start smoothly under the conditions that the swinging angle of the operating handle is quite small and the rotating amplitude of the accelerating knob is the maximum, the running speed of the forklift is limited according to the swinging angle of the operating handle, and therefore the potential safety hazard that the forklift pulls a driver to run is effectively avoided. The invention further discloses a speed control device of the forklift and the forklift comprising the speed control device of the forklift.

Description

technical field [0001] The invention relates to the technical field of vehicles, in particular to a speed control method of a forklift, a speed control device of a forklift and a forklift. Background technique [0002] In the related art, when operating the handle operating lever in the pedestrian-operated forklift, the handle angle sensor outputs an open sensing signal or a closing sensing signal to the main controller, and then the main controller The signals perform two different operations respectively. Specifically, the main controller controls the drive motor to "rotate" or "not rotate" according to the on-sensing signal or the off-sensing signal.
